The First Step Of Walk; Poem by Sadashivan Nair

The First Step Of Walk;



My legs wobbled,
Fell time and again;
With several attempts,
And rose again;
Then moved one leg
Ahead to walk;
Though was scary,
Fearing would fall,
Hurt my knees;
Never realized
That first Move,
Was decisive for
Long journey of my life;
Moved on the journey
Through its road;
Though was always difficult,
Scary, tiresome, confusing;
Journey was no so easy,
Enduring pain, sorrow and stress,
Together built my grit;
Never knew where, and,
What the journey meant for;
Would I reach or
Would retreat in the midst of life,
But step by step,
Stage by stage the path,
Began to familiar with my choice;
I too began to acquaint,
Ups and down of path;
